Borno State Gov Zulum Issues Statement Denying His Son Is Held For Murder in India

Borno State Governor, Professor Babagana Zulum has said his son is not currently held in custody in India over any alleged murder as is being circulated in the social media.....
The governor in a signed statement by the media unit in his office, said the report was false and far from the truth.


The report alleged that the governor son was in a club and drank alcohol.He then allegedly had a fight with someone who had eyes for the lady he was also seeing and that he broke a bottle on the mans head killing him....

The statement on Wednesday signed by Abdurrahman Bundi, the Senior Special Assistant to the Governor on New Media, read: “The Borno State Governor’s media unit‘s attention has been drawn to rumours circulating that the son of the Borno State Governor has been arrested for the alleged murder of some Indian citizen.
“This misinformation was published in an online blog, Nairaland, titled ‘Son of Borno State Governor Murders Someone In India—Politics.’ The blog claimed that the Governor also travelled to India, attempting to use diplomatic status to resolve the matter.
“It is on record that Governor Babagana Zulum was on a one-month vacation in Saudi Arabia for the 2024 Hajj and later travelled to Egypt to attend the annual ASUWAN forum conference in Cairo.
“The Media Unit would like to clarify and set the record straight that N******** and other online blogs have mischievously spread defamatory content without any speck of truth.
“We hereby warn N******d and all those who have spread the false information to pull down this misinformation from its website and platforms within the next 24 hours and offer an unreserved apology to Governor Zulum, his son, and the entire family, or risk legal action.
“The Governor shall also not hesitate to take legal action against any media outlet that continues to publicise this defamatory information on its platform.
“We would like to inform the public that none of Governor’s Zulum’s son was either arrested or charged with any crime, or involved in any unlawful activities anywhere.
“We urge the public to exercise caution when consuming and sharing information, particularly when it comes from unverified sources and blogs instead of credible media outlets.
“We enjoin all media organisations to engage in responsible journalism of truth and factual verification while recognising the potential harm and psychological trauma the spread of false information might have caused to the Governor’s family.”
